Silky Greek Yogurt Protein Cheesecake

Enjoy a luscious, creamy cheesecake that combines the richness of full-fat Greek yogurt with a light tang of cream cheese, all on a nutty almond flour crust. This dessert is perfectly balanced to deliver a satisfying texture and subtly sweet flavor, making it a delightful treat that still supports your protein goals.

NUTRITION

776kcal
Protein
54g
Fat
43g
Carbs
43g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1 cup Full-Fat Greek Yogurt

4 ounces Low-Fat Cream Cheese

3 Egg Whites

1/2 cup Almond Flour

1 tablespoon Honey

1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 325°F (163°C).

  • 2

    In a medium bowl, mix the almond flour and a pinch of cinnamon if desired, then press the mixture firmly into the base of a springform pan to form an even crust.

  • 3

    In a large bowl, blend the full-fat Greek yogurt, cream cheese, and egg whites until smooth and silky. Stir in the honey and vanilla extract until fully incorporated.

  • 4

    Pour the creamy mixture over the prepared crust, smoothing the top with a spatula.

  • 5

    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until the edges are set but the center remains slightly wobbly.

  • 6

    Remove from the oven and let cool at room temperature, then chill in the refrigerator for at least 3 hours before serving.

  • 7

    Slice and enjoy a silky, protein-packed cheesecake that balances indulgence with your nutritional goals.
